Ann Loretta Salewske, the daughter of Christian and Rose (Rekow) Petersen, was born
September 1, 1920 in Willow Lake Township, Redwood County. She was raised on the
family farm in Willow Lake Township and received her elementary education in Wanda
Public School. Ann attended high school in Lamberton and graduated with the Class of
1938.
In April 1940, Ann married John Salewske in Arnold’s Park, Iowa. The couple farmed, and
raised their family, in the Wanda and Clements areas. Following John’s death in 1969, Ann
moved into Redwood Falls. She was employed by Control Data in Redwood Falls for 16
years; Ann then served as Bailiff for Fifth District Court for over 20 years.
She was a member of Gloria Dei Lutheran Church where she served on the Altar Guild and
funeral committee. Ann made quilts for missions with her fellow quilters at Gloria Dei and
taught Sunday school at Christ Lutheran in Wanda. She was an active member of the
American Legion Auxiliary and served as its chaplain. Ann also belonged to bowling league
and card club.
